Why Reliable Weather Information Matters for Glasgow

Let's be real, guys, the weather in Glasgow isn't just small talk; it's a significant factor in daily life. We've all experienced those days where a sudden downpour can derail your plans, or a surprisingly sunny spell makes you want to head outdoors. This is precisely why having access to reliable BBC Weather Glasgow updates is so important. Glasgow, situated in the west of Scotland, often experiences a maritime climate, characterized by mild, wet winters and cool, damp summers. However, this can be highly variable. You might get sunshine, rain, wind, and even hail all within a few hours! This unpredictability makes accurate forecasting crucial. For residents, it means knowing whether to dress in layers, pack an umbrella (a must-have in Glasgow, let's be honest!), or if it's safe to undertake outdoor activities. Think about events like the West End Festival or the sheer number of people who enjoy walks along the River Clyde or exploring the nearby hills – all highly weather-dependent. For businesses, it's also critical. Construction projects need to factor in potential weather delays. Retailers need to manage stock based on seasonal demand, which is heavily influenced by the weather. Outdoor cafes and restaurants rely on good weather to attract customers. Even the city's infrastructure needs to be prepared. Heavy rainfall can impact drainage systems, and strong winds can affect power lines. The BBC Weather service, with its detailed local forecasts, helps everyone from individuals to city planners make better decisions. By providing timely and accurate information, BBC Weather empowers the people of Glasgow to navigate their days more effectively and safely. It’s not just about knowing if it will rain; it's about understanding the intensity, the duration, and potential associated risks, allowing for better preparation and mitigation.
